Location: Tel Aviv-Yafo
Job Type: Full Time
We are looking for an experienced and visionary Data Platform Engineer to help design, build and scale our BI platform from the ground up.

In this role, you will be responsible for building the foundations of our data analytics platform enabling scalable data pipelines and robust data modeling to support real-time and batch analytics, ML models and business insights that serve both business intelligence and product needs.

You will be part of the R&D team, collaborating closely with engineers, analysts, and product managers to deliver a modern data architecture that supports internal dashboards and future-facing operational analytics.

If you enjoy architecting from scratch, turning raw data into powerful insights, and owning the full data lifecycle this role is for you!

Responsibilities
Take full ownership of the design and implementation of a scalable and efficient BI data infrastructure, ensuring high performance, reliability and security.

Lead the design and architecture of the data platform from integration to transformation, modeling, storage, and access.

Build and maintain ETL/ELT pipelines, batch and real-time, to support analytics, reporting, and product integrations.

Establish and enforce best practices for data quality, lineage, observability, and governance to ensure accuracy and consistency.

Integrate modern tools and frameworks such as Airflow, dbt, Databricks, Power BI, and streaming platforms.

Collaborate cross-functionally with product, engineering, and analytics teams to translate business needs into data infrastructure.

Promote a data-driven culture be an advocate for data-driven decision-making across the company by empowering stakeholders with reliable and self-service data access.
Requirements:
5+ years of hands-on experience in data engineering and in building data products for analytics and business intelligence.

Proven track record of designing and implementing large-scale data platforms or ETL architectures from the ground up.

Strong hands-on experience with ETL tools and data Warehouse/Lakehouse products (Airflow, Airbyte, dbt, Databricks)

Experience supporting both batch pipelines and real-time streaming architectures (e.g., Kafka, Spark Streaming).

Proficiency in Python, SQL, and cloud data engineering environments (AWS, Azure, or GCP).

Familiarity with data visualization tools like Power BI, Looker, or similar.

BSc in Computer Science or a related field from a leading university
This position is open to all candidates.

We are looking for a hands-on data infrastructure and platform engineer with proven leadership skills to lead and evolve our self-service data platform that powers petabyte-scale batch and streaming, near-real-time analytics, experimentation, and the feature platform. Youll guide an already excellent team of senior engineers, own reliability and cost efficiency, and be the focal point for pivotal, company-wide data initiatives- feature platform, lakehouse, and streaming.
Own the lakehouse backbone: Mature Iceberg at high scalepartitioning, compaction, retention, metadataand extend our IcebergManager in-house product to automate the lakehouse management in a self serve fashion.
Unify online/offline for features: Drive Flink adoption and patterns that keep features consistent and low-latency for experimentation and production.
Make self-serve real: Build golden paths, templates, and guardrails so product/analytics/DS engineers can move fast safely.
Run multi-tenant compute efficiently: EMR on EKS powered by Karpenter on Spot instances; right-size Trino/Spark/Druid for performance and cost.
Cross-cloud interoperability: BigQuery + BigLake/Iceberg interop where it makes sense (analytics, experimentation, partnership).
What you'll be doing
Leading a senior Data Platform team: setting clear objectives, unblocking execution, and raising the engineering bar.
Owning SLOs, on-call, incident response, and postmortems for core data services.
Designing and operating EMR on EKS capacity profiles, autoscaling policies, and multi-tenant isolation.
Tuning Trino (memory/spill, CBO, catalogs), Spark/Structured Streaming jobs, and Druid ingestion/compaction for sub-second analytics.
Extending Flink patterns for the feature platform (state backends, checkpointing, watermarks, backfills).
Driving FinOps work: CUR-based attribution, S3 Inventory-driven retention/compaction, Reservations/Savings Plans strategy, OpenCost visibility.
Partnering with product engineering, analytics, and data science & ML engineers on roadmap, schema evolution, and data product SLAs.
Leveling up observability (Prometheus/VictoriaMetrics/Grafana), data quality checks, and platform self-service tooling.
Requirements:
2+ years leading engineers (team lead or manager) building/operating large-scale data platforms; 5+ years total in Data Infrastructure/DataOps roles.
Proven ownership of cloud-native data platforms on AWS: S3, EMR (preferably EMR on EKS), IAM, Glue/Data Catalog, Athena.
Production experience with Apache Iceberg (schema evolution, compaction, retention, metadata ops) and columnar formats (Parquet/Avro).
Hands-on depth in at least two of: Trino/Presto, Apache Spark/Structured Streaming, Apache Druid, Apache Flink.
Strong conceptual understanding of Kubernetes (EKS), including autoscaling, isolation, quotas, and observability
Strong SQL skills and extensive experience with performance tuning, with solid proficiency in Python/Java.
Solid understanding of Kafka concepts, hands-on experience is a plus
Experience running on-call for data platforms and driving measurable SLO-based improvements.
You might also have
Experience building feature platforms (feature definitions, materialization, serving, and online/offline consistency).
Airflow (or similar) at scale; Argo experience is a plus.
Familiarity with BigQuery (and ideally BigLake/Iceberg interop) and operational DBs like Aurora MySQL.
Experience with Clickhouse / Snowflake / Databricks / Starrocks.
FinOps background (cost attribution/showback, Spot strategies).
Data quality, lineage, and cataloging practices in large orgs.
IaC (Terraform/CloudFormation).
